Jerquavious Johnson Jr., 25, of Bossier City, was killed during a shooting on Easter Sunday in Shreveport. The incident occurred during a weekend gathering on W. 7th Street, where gunfire erupted, leaving Johnson fatally wounded.
He was transported to a local hospital, where he was pronounced dead at 11:37 p.m., according to the Caddo Parish Coroner’s Office. Johnson was confirmed through fingerprint identification, and authorities have ordered an autopsy as part of the ongoing investigation into his death.
Shreveport Police reported that Johnson’s death represents the fifth homicide in the city and Caddo Parish for 2026. Another individual arrived at the hospital later after sustaining a minor gunshot graze.
Police noted that two vehicles at the scene had bullet damage to their windshields, while a third vehicle had a hole in the driver’s side window.
